Shopping the KSL classifieds


We needed furniture badly. We didn't have much money to buy it. We WON'T go into debt for furniture!!!

What's a person to do, then?

Shop the classifieds, of course! ksl.com has an extremely comprehensive classified section where everyone is selling everything! I have spent the past week searching for just the right things to go into my house. I have driven all over the Wasatch Front looking at and collecting furniture.

The sectional (which will have a leather ottoman) was bought direct from the factory in West Jordan. The maker let us pick the fabric/leather and whether the cushions would be attached or detached (detached!). He told us it would take two weeks to build. However, when we made our selections, he told us there was one already built to those exact specs in the back! Someone else had ordered it, then couldn't come up with the money to pay. Their loss was our gain! That is why we have the sectional, but not the ottoman. It is still being built.

It cost a bit more to order brand new, but couches can be a scary thing to buy used, you know? And we saved about $1,000 by going directly to the maker!

The table and chair set came from Spanish Fork. A young couple there bought it, put it together, then discovered it was too small for their family! They never even used it! Brand new table and 6 chairs for $300!

Not pictured is my new dining room table. It is a 6' solid oak mission style table with an additional 17" leaf extension. $100!!! A lady in Bountiful was downscaling in the aftermath of a divorce. I also collected two gorgeous dining chairs from a lady in Pleasant Grove ($60 for both). She never did say why she no longer wanted them. They look very nice with the table. I plan to create an eclectic collection of dining chairs over time. It should be fun to wait and hunt for perfect pieces that fit my budget ($50 or less per chair).

I am done shopping the classifieds, for now. Other than the chair collecting, of course. That could take some time.
